Blind Obsession

Rate this book
She was determined to hide her identity

Claire de Montebourg was running, running from a terrible truth she did not want to believe. But when her car slithered dangerously across a country road during the storm, a flat tire threatened to ruin all her plans.

Then a pair of blinding headlights flashed out of the gloom, and a young man who introduced himself as Dave Heron entered her life.

"How far are you going, Miss, er--"

"Francine. Francine Severac," she lied. A look of disbelief spread across his face and panic rose in her. Had she been recognized? Was the charade already over?
